Easy Kids' Tent/ Reading Nook by thelawrencegirl, ana-white.com: A simple project using pine boards, hex nuts and bolts and tab top curtain panels that comes together in about an hour. #Play_Tent #Kids #thelawrencegirl #ana_white
Beautiful Reading Canopy by sewliberated: Made by sewing silk onto a circular hand quilting hoop which was suspended with hemp twine to a sling ring and then hung from a ceiling hook with fishing wire. Another square of white silk was draped over the top. #Reading_Canopy #Play_Tent #sewliberated
